METHOD, COMPUTER PROGRAM, SYSTEM AND COMPUTER SYSTEM FOR ELIMINATING NOISE IN AN IMAGE SEQUENCE
WO21229129
Provided are methods, programs and systems for eliminating noise in an image sequence produced by a method for generating images with volumetric data, using an algorithm for tracing light ray paths in participating media. Each image in the sequence comprises pixels, and the path-tracing algorithm produces path samples for each pixel. These methods comprise, for each pixel of a current image in the sequence: temporarily reprojecting the pixel according to a motion vector to obtain an average accumulated colour and a predictive model of the pixel; averaging a colour of the pixel with the average accumulated colour to obtain an updated average accumulated colour; including the updated average accumulated colour in a feature vector; and determining a final colour of the pixel by updating the predictive model according to the updated feature vector and obtaining the final colour from the updated predictive model.

This technique introduces one of the first practical approximations for the noise elimination in real-time, suitable for the volumetric data visualization systems based on 3-D reconstruction algorithms simulating photorrealistic illumination effects (CVR). It allows a significantly reduction in the levels of noise in sequency of images generated by MC rendering techniques (VPT)
This technique and technology improves the quality of image at a very advanced levels, which makes it suitable for 3-D visualization, medical (diagnostic imaging), AR and VR, autonomous driving, musealistic installations...
Currently working on TRL 5 achievement with external institutions, and open to discuss collaboration opportunities.



.jpg)